In recent years, India has witnessed a remarkable boom in its gig economy, particularly in the online food delivery and home services sectors. Companies like Zomato and Swiggy have not only made waves in food delivery but have also gone public, showcasing the potential of this rapidly growing market. Additionally, the rise of cloud kitchens has further transformed how people experience food delivery.
Alongside the food delivery revolution, platforms that offer on-demand home services are gaining traction. Startups such as Urban Company, Snabbit, and Pronto are stepping up to meet the increasing demand for household staffing. They provide a range of services, from cleaning to handyman work, making everyday life a bit easier for many.
Amidst this bustling gig economy, a California-based startup named Human Archive is making strides by harnessing the power of these home services. Their approach is quite unique and could redefine how we train robots. By collaborating with these service-oriented companies, Human Archive is able to collect valuable data that can be used to enhance robotic learning.
But how exactly does it work? Human Archive equips gig workers with specially designed caps that come with built-in cameras. These caps capture egocentric video footage—think of it as a first-person perspective of daily tasks. This data is invaluable for training robots in performing similar tasks, as they can learn from real-life scenarios captured in these videos.
This innovative method of data collection has the potential to bridge the gap between human actions and robotic responses. By analyzing the way humans perform tasks, robots can learn to replicate these actions more effectively. For instance, training a robot to clean a house would involve understanding how a human moves through the space, what tools they use, and the sequence of their actions.
Consider a simple task like washing dishes. By studying the video data, a robot could learn the proper movements required to scrub, rinse, and place dishes in a drying rack. This real-world application of data collection not only enhances the robot’s functionality but also makes it more adaptable to various environments and situations.
